Immunocytochemistry/ Immunofluorescence - Anti-P2X2 antibody [EPR25193-215] (AB327423)
Immunofluorescent analysis of 4% Paraformaldehyde-fixed, 0.1% TritonX-100 permeabilized SK-N-MC (human brain epithelial cell) and A431 (human epidermoid carcinoma epithelial cell) cells labelling P2X2 with ab327423 at 1/50 (10.06 μg/ml) dilution, followed by ab150081 Goat Anti-Rabbit IgG H&L (Alexa Fluor® 488) preadsorbed antibody at 1/1000 dilution (Green).
Confocal image showing membranous staining in SK-N-MC cell line and no staining in A431 cell line(shown in green). The counterstain was observed in magenta. Nuclear DNA was labelled with DAPI (shown in blue).
Low expression : A431.
Image was taken with a confocal microscope (Leica-Microsystems, TCS SP8).
ab7291 Anti-alpha Tubulin mouse monoclonal antibody was used to counterstain tubulin at 1/1000 (1 ug/ml) dilution, followed by ab150120 Goat Anti-Mouse IgG H&L (Alexa Fluor® 594) at 1/1000 (2 ug/ml) dilution (Magenta).

Immunohistochemistry (Formalin/PFA-fixed paraffin-embedded sections) - Anti-P2X2 antibody [EPR25193-215] (AB327423)
Immunohistochemical analysis of paraffin-embedded Human glioma tissue labeling P2X2 with ab327423 at 1/500 (1.006 μg/ml) dilution, followed by a ready to use LeicaDS9800 (Bond™ Polymer Refine Detection).
Positive on human glioma. The primary antibody was incubated for 30 mins at room temperature.
The immunostaining was performed on a Leica Biosystems BOND® RX instrument
Counterstained with Hematoxylin.
Secondary antibody only control : Secondary antibody is a ready to use LeicaDS9800 (Bond™ Polymer Refine Detection).
Heat mediated antigen retrieval was performed with Tris-EDTA buffer (pH 9.0, Epitope Retrieval Solution2) for 20 mins
